C. For each of the following sentences, change the subject of the vert to the plural,and change the verb so that it agrees with its subject.

1. The room is clean.
2. The cake was being baked.
3. The crow was sitting on the tree.
4. The singer performed with the orchestra,
5. The elephant was running in the field.
6. The ship lies off the coast of America,
7. The bike is sold.
8. The cake has been baked.
9. The girl won the race.
10. The casino was open until one o'clock in the morning.
11. Bad habit should be avoided.
12. The ratio has been favourable.​

Required Answers :-

1. The rooms are clean.

2. The cakes were being baked.

3. The crows were sitting on the tree.

4. The singers performed with the orchestra,

5. The elephants were running in the field.

6. The ships lie off the coast of America,

7. The bikes are sold.

8. The cakes have been baked.

9. The girls won the race.

10. The casinos were open until one o'clock in the morning.

11. Bad habits should be avoided.

12. The ratios have been favourable.

Explore More :-

  • The subject can be turned into plural form by add-ing 's' or 'es' as per requirements. Though there are lots of rules to transform singular to plural one, in the above questions, adding 's' they have been turned into plural form.
  • The be verbs is/am, was get changed into are, were in plural respectively.
  • 'Has' get changed into 'have' in plural.
  • The modals don't get change into plural.
  • In past tense, the main verb remained unchanged while turning into plural.
